Understanding Your Dental Needs
Before initiating your search for a dentist, it's crucial to assess your personal dental needs. Are you looking for preventive care, cosmetic work, or specialized treatments? Each type of service caters to different requirements, making it essential to clarify your needs first. For example, if you only require routine cleanings and exams, a general dentist would suffice. Conversely, if you seek cosmetic enhancements like veneers or teeth whitening, you might need a dentist with expertise in cosmetic dentistry.

How Check-ups Prevent Major Issues
Dental check-ups can prevent minor problems from escalating into severe concerns. Regular exams allow dentists to identify early signs of cavities, gum disease, or oral cancer. By catching issues early, you can avoid extensive treatments and save time and money. Consistent examinations are an investment in your long-term health.
What to Expect During a Dental Visit
During a typical dental visit, you can expect a series of steps to ensure your oral health is on track. This typically starts with a thorough cleaning by a dental hygienist, followed by an examination conducted by the dentist. X-rays may also be taken to visualize areas not seen during the standard exam. Your dentist will discuss findings and potential treatment options if any issues arise.
